Seven LA Valley Players Sign
At Four Year Schools--(May 18, 2000)

We've already reported on most of the signings from this past spring, but it's always nice to see which JC's have been productive and successful in placing their players with four year colleges, so at the risk of being redundant, here's a press release we received this morning from the Athletic Department at LA Valley College about their five signees to four year Division I from this year's team and two others from two years ago who finished their AA degrees and signed with D-I schools.  Here's the release:

Monarch Basketball Moves Players Forward

VALLEY GLEN—The Western State Conference basketball champions are showing their strength again as they enter mid-May with five players having signed letters of intent to four-year schools.

All-State selection and WSC MVP Felix Lang joins two-time All-Conference choice Jerrohn Jordan as they head for Portland State University of the Big Sky Conference. Jordan is a local product who prepped at Valencia High School.

Issac Williamson, another All-Conference performer and 6-9 postman Wayne Huff have signed with Fort Hays State University in Kansas. Co-captain and two-year starting point guard Joe Bakhoum will move to Oklahoma Panhandle State University to continue his career.

One starter from the 1998-99 squad has completed his Associate of Arts Degree and has also signed. George Walker has signed with Texas A & M (Corpus Christi).

Monarch basketball capped off a highly successful season last March by competing in final-four action at the state championships following a 27-9 season.
